Introduction to Shoulder Strength and Stability

The shoulders are one of the most mobile joints in the body, which makes them both versatile and vulnerable to injury. Developing shoulder strength and stability is crucial for athletes, fitness enthusiasts, and anyone looking to maintain healthy and functional movement patterns.

In this article, we will explore the importance of strengthening your shoulder muscles and provide effective exercises to improve both strength and stability, ensuring that your shoulders are not only powerful but also protected from injury.

Why Shoulder Strength and Stability Matter

Shoulder strength and stability are essential for a wide range of daily activities and sports. Whether you’re lifting, pushing, or throwing, a strong and stable shoulder allows for controlled, efficient movement, while reducing the risk of strain or injury. Without proper strength and stability, the shoulder joint becomes susceptible to overuse injuries, such as rotator cuff tears, impingement, or tendinitis.

Building both strength and stability in your shoulder muscles will improve posture, increase range of motion, and support overall joint health, contributing to better performance in sports and everyday activities.

Top Shoulder Exercises for Strength

Strengthening the muscles around the shoulder joint is key to improving overall shoulder performance. Here are some of the most effective exercises for building shoulder strength:

  • Overhead Press: This compound exercise works the deltoid muscles and engages the triceps, providing strength and stability. Start with dumbbells or a barbell and press the weight overhead in a controlled motion.
  • Front and Lateral Raises: These exercises target the front and lateral deltoids, helping to build the strength needed for shoulder mobility and stability. Perform with dumbbells for controlled lifting and lowering.
  • Push-Ups: A classic bodyweight exercise, push-ups engage the chest, shoulders, and triceps, and can help develop strength and endurance in the shoulders. For added challenge, try variations like diamond push-ups or decline push-ups.

These exercises should be done with proper form to ensure effective strengthening and to prevent injury. Start with moderate weights and gradually increase resistance as your muscles adapt.

Stability Exercises to Prevent Injury

Stability exercises are crucial for building endurance and preventing injury in the shoulder joint. These exercises improve coordination and control, which are necessary for maintaining shoulder health during high-impact movements. Try these stability-focused shoulder exercises:

  • External Rotations: Use a resistance band or dumbbells for this exercise. Focus on rotating your arm outward while keeping your elbow fixed at a 90-degree angle to engage the rotator cuff muscles.
  • Plank to Downward Dog: This dynamic exercise targets the shoulders, core, and arms. Start in a plank position, then shift to a downward dog position, focusing on pushing your shoulders back and engaging your core for stability.
  • Single-Arm Dumbbell Rows: This exercise helps build shoulder stability by engaging the muscles of the upper back and shoulders. Perform it with a dumbbell while maintaining proper posture and a controlled motion.

Incorporating stability exercises into your routine will ensure that your shoulders stay resilient and protected during both strength training and functional movements.

How to Incorporate Shoulder Exercises Into Your Routine

To effectively strengthen and stabilize your shoulders, it's important to incorporate exercises into your workout routine regularly. Aim for at least two shoulder-focused workouts per week, combining strength exercises and stability training. Here’s how you can structure your workouts:

  • Warm-Up: Start with dynamic stretching or light cardio to increase blood flow to the shoulders.
  • Strength Training: Choose two to three exercises focused on building strength, such as overhead presses or lateral raises. Perform 3-4 sets of 8-12 repetitions per exercise.
  • Stability Training: Follow up with stability exercises like external rotations and plank variations. Perform 2-3 sets with 12-15 repetitions.
  • Cool Down: Finish with stretching and mobility work to maintain flexibility and improve joint health.

By consistently training your shoulders with both strength and stability exercises, you’ll improve your shoulder health and reduce the risk of injury, enabling you to lift heavier, move more freely, and feel confident in your physical activities.
